首页
云原生
docker
containerd
Kubernetes
Prometheus
基础知识
操作系统
计算机网络
Linux基础
基础设施
Nginx
Devops
gitlab
jenkins
Maven
Ansible
前端
日志监控
数据库
MySQL
Redis
Oracle
编程
shell
python
其他
hyperledger-fabric
系统安全
运维相关工具
友情链接
归档
关于
Gaoyufu 's blog
好好活就是有意义的事,有意义的事就是好好活
累计撰写
257
篇文章
累计创建
92
个标签
累计收到
6
条评论
栏目
首页
云原生
docker
containerd
Kubernetes
Prometheus
基础知识
操作系统
计算机网络
Linux基础
基础设施
Nginx
Devops
gitlab
jenkins
Maven
Ansible
前端
日志监控
数据库
MySQL
Redis
Oracle
编程
shell
python
其他
hyperledger-fabric
系统安全
运维相关工具
友情链接
归档
关于
目 录
CONTENT
自动化-Gaoyufu 's blog
以下是
自动化
相关的文章
2020-07-27
saltstack安装配置和使用
该文章摘要为:文章介绍了SaltStack的安装配置过程,包括服务组件安装、服务启动、配置认证、grains组件、pillar组件的配置和使用。同时,文章还介绍了Saltstack配置管理服务,包括配置安装apache、远程文件管理、文件夹管理、远程执行命令和远程执行shell脚本的使用。整个安装配置过程详细记录了每个步骤的操作和结果,为使用者提供了详细的指导。
2020-07-27
60
0
0
Ansible
Devops
2020-03-09
Ansible自动化运维
这篇文章摘要总结: Ansible是一款基于Python开发的自动化运维工具,具有易开发、模块丰富、无客户端、管理模式简单等特点。Ansible可用于自动化配置管理、应用部署、任务自动化等场景。它包含丰富的内置模块和工具集,支持多种平台,并已被多家知名公司使用。 Ansible的工具集包括Playbooks(任务脚本)、Inventory(主机清单)、Modules(执行命令功能模块)、Plugins(模块功能的补充)和API(供第三方程序调用的应用程序编程接口)。 安装Ansible时,需要先安装Python,然后通过yum或wget命令下载Ansible软件包进行安装,并生成密钥对进行主机间的免密码登录。 Ansible的配置包括hosts文件(管理主机清单)和Ansible配置文件(/etc/ansible/ansible.cfg)。 Ansible命令用于执行特定的任务,如ping主机、运行命令、执行playbook等。Ansible-doc命令用于查看Ansible支持的模块和模块的说明信息。 Ansible模块包括command、shell、copy、hostname、yum、service、user、group、file、mount等,用于执行各种任务,如安装软件、复制文件、创建用户等。 Playbook是Ansible的配置文件,包含要执行的任务代码,通过ansible-playbook命令执行。 Ansible还支持触发器(handlers)和角色(roles)功能,触发器是在特定条件下触发的任务,角色是由tasks、handlers等组成的特定结构集合。 通过Ansible,可以构建复杂的运维环境,如web-nfs-rsync架构环境,包括配置rsync服务、nfs服务、sersync服务、httpd服务等。
2020-03-09
88
0
0
Ansible
Devops